Lambda Fiber Stubs

Implantable lambda fiber stubs are designed for illuminating large volumes of tissue in a more homogeneous way than standard optical fibers. They can be customized for your experiments. Match the numerical aperture and core size to your current experiment to incorporate these fiber stubs into your existing experimental design.

Lambda Fiber Stubs (NA, ID, OD)

Active Length

0.22 NA/105 µm/125µm

0.5, 1.0, 1.5 mm

0.39 NA/200 µm/225µm

0.5, 1.0, 1.5, 2.0, 2.5 mm

0.66 NA/200 µm/230µm

0.5, 1.0, 1.5, 2.0, 2.5 mm

Implant Length

0-20 mm

Fiber stubs are defined by the fiber specifications including:

  • Numerical Aperture (NA)
  • Inner/Outer Diameter (ID/OD) of core size
  • Taper Active Length (5% tolerance)
  • Implant Length (mm)
  • Connector Type (Ceramic Ferrule, Stainless Steel Ferrule)
